Ancillary Synthesis Suite

PARADIM boasts significant ancillary synthesis capabilities to meet user needs. This includes box and tube furnaces, a multizone chemical vapor transport furnace, and a glove box adopted arc melting furnace for air sensitive materials.

MOCVD1

The MOCVD1 system is a cold-wall, 2-inch wafer MOCVD reactor (SiC-coated susceptor) up to 1000 °C, water-cooled, with wafer rotation for uniformity. It features a nitrogen-purged glovebox, gas panel, LabView control, six bubblers, H2Se/H2S lines, H2/N2 process gases, 10–700 Torr, exhaust scrubber, and a 16-point chemcassette monitor with interlock.
